N-Fmoc-4,6-benzylidene-2’3’4’6’-tetra-O-acetyl T Epitope, Threonyl Allyl Ester

Base Information Edit
  • Chemical Name:N-Fmoc-4,6-benzylidene-2’3’4’6’-tetra-O-acetyl T Epitope, Threonyl Allyl Ester
  • CAS No.:384346-85-4
  • Molecular Formula:C51H58N2O19
  • Molecular Weight:1003.02

synthetic route:
Guidance literature:
Multi-step reaction with 6 steps
1.1: aq. CsCO3 / ethanol / pH 7
1.2: 90 percent / dimethylformamide / 3.5 h / 0 - 20 °C
2.1: 50 percent / N-bromosuccinimide; tetrabutylammonium triflate / CH2Cl2 / -28 °C
3.1: 97 percent / aq. TFA / CH2Cl2 / 8 h / 0 °C
4.1: 87 percent / p-TsOH*H2O / acetonitrile / 24 h / 20 °C
5.1: 59 percent / silver triflate / toluene; CH2Cl2 / 1 h / -25 °C
6.1: 86 percent / pyridine / 8 h / 20 °C
With pyridine; N-Bromosuccinimide; silver trifluoromethanesulfonate; tetrabutylammonium trifluoromethylsulfonate; toluene-4-sulfonic acid; trifluoroacetic acid; In ethanol; dichloromethane; toluene; acetonitrile;
DOI:10.1021/ja015570t
Guidance literature:
Multi-step reaction with 3 steps
1: 87 percent / p-TsOH*H2O / acetonitrile / 24 h / 20 °C
2: 59 percent / silver triflate / toluene; CH2Cl2 / 1 h / -25 °C
3: 86 percent / pyridine / 8 h / 20 °C
With pyridine; silver trifluoromethanesulfonate; toluene-4-sulfonic acid; In dichloromethane; toluene; acetonitrile;
DOI:10.1021/ja015570t
